Specifications
Botanical Name: Ipomoea spp.
Common Name: Blue Moonflower
Seed Type: Non-GMO
Plant Type: Tender Perennial (grown as Annual in cool climates)
Growth Habit: Climbing vine
Bloom Color: Blue
Blooming Season: Summer to fall
Hardiness Zones: USDA Zones 9–11
Sun Exposure: Full sun
Soil Requirements: Well-drained, fertile soil
Water Needs: Moderate
Plant Height: Up to 10–15 feet when supported
Spacing: 12–18 inches
Germination Time: 7–21 days
Growing Season: Spring and early summer
Planting Guide:
-
Soak seeds for 12–24 hours before planting
-
Sow outdoors after frost or start indoors 4–6 weeks early
-
Plant 1/4 inch deep in warm soil
-
Provide strong support for climbing
-
Water regularly but avoid waterlogging
-
Place in full sun for best flowering
